Frank Leslie Davis

(Confirmed)

Born: 27 January, 1891

Died: 20 March, 1952

Service Number: 5465

Ranks:

  • Held rank of Driver
  • Held rank of Gunner

Birth Records:

  • 27 January, 1891 in Lewisham

Death Records:

  • 20 March, 1952 in Rose Bay

Address:

  • 71 Spit Road Mosman NSW Australia

Relationships:

  • father - Edwin Thomas Davis
  • mother - Mary Annie Henlen

Organisations:

  • Member of - 1st Australian Divisional Ammunition Column
  • Member of - 1st Australian Field Artillery Brigade
